Lines Matching refs:rf

52 rtw_rf_init(struct rtw_rf *rf, uint_t freq, uint8_t opaque_txpower,  in rtw_rf_init()  argument
55 return (*rf->rf_init)(rf, freq, opaque_txpower, power); in rtw_rf_init()
59 rtw_rf_tune(struct rtw_rf *rf, uint_t freq) in rtw_rf_tune() argument
61 return (*rf->rf_tune)(rf, freq); in rtw_rf_tune()
65 rtw_rf_txpower(struct rtw_rf *rf, uint8_t opaque_txpower) in rtw_rf_txpower() argument
67 return (*rf->rf_txpower)(rf, opaque_txpower); in rtw_rf_txpower()
125 rtw_sa2400_txpower(struct rtw_rf *rf, uint8_t opaque_txpower) in rtw_sa2400_txpower() argument
127 struct rtw_sa2400 *sa = (struct rtw_sa2400 *)rf; in rtw_sa2400_txpower()
192 rtw_sa2400_tune(struct rtw_rf *rf, uint_t freq) in rtw_sa2400_tune() argument
194 struct rtw_sa2400 *sa = (struct rtw_sa2400 *)rf; in rtw_sa2400_tune()
234 rtw_sa2400_pwrstate(struct rtw_rf *rf, enum rtw_pwrstate power) in rtw_sa2400_pwrstate() argument
236 struct rtw_sa2400 *sa = (struct rtw_sa2400 *)rf; in rtw_sa2400_pwrstate()
326 struct rtw_rf *rf = &sa->sa_rf; in rtw_sa2400_dc_calibration() local
330 (*rf->rf_continuous_tx_cb)(rf->rf_continuous_tx_arg, 1); in rtw_sa2400_dc_calibration()
350 (*rf->rf_continuous_tx_cb)(rf->rf_continuous_tx_arg, 0); in rtw_sa2400_dc_calibration()
370 rtw_sa2400_destroy(struct rtw_rf *rf) in rtw_sa2400_destroy() argument
372 struct rtw_sa2400 *sa = (struct rtw_sa2400 *)rf; in rtw_sa2400_destroy()
377 rtw_sa2400_calibrate(struct rtw_rf *rf, uint_t freq) in rtw_sa2400_calibrate() argument
379 struct rtw_sa2400 *sa = (struct rtw_sa2400 *)rf; in rtw_sa2400_calibrate()
392 if ((rc = rtw_sa2400_tune(rf, freq)) != 0) in rtw_sa2400_calibrate()
405 rtw_sa2400_init(struct rtw_rf *rf, uint_t freq, uint8_t opaque_txpower, in rtw_sa2400_init() argument
408 struct rtw_sa2400 *sa = (struct rtw_sa2400 *)rf; in rtw_sa2400_init()
411 if ((rc = rtw_sa2400_txpower(rf, opaque_txpower)) != 0) in rtw_sa2400_init()
418 return (rtw_sa2400_pwrstate(rf, power)); in rtw_sa2400_init()
423 if ((rc = rtw_sa2400_pwrstate(rf, RTW_SLEEP)) != 0) in rtw_sa2400_init()
426 if ((rc = rtw_sa2400_tune(rf, freq)) != 0) in rtw_sa2400_init()
432 if ((rc = rtw_sa2400_calibrate(rf, freq)) != 0) in rtw_sa2400_init()
438 return (rtw_sa2400_pwrstate(rf, power)); in rtw_sa2400_init()
446 struct rtw_rf *rf; in rtw_sa2400_create() local
455 rf = &sa->sa_rf; in rtw_sa2400_create()
458 rf->rf_init = rtw_sa2400_init; in rtw_sa2400_create()
459 rf->rf_destroy = rtw_sa2400_destroy; in rtw_sa2400_create()
460 rf->rf_txpower = rtw_sa2400_txpower; in rtw_sa2400_create()
461 rf->rf_tune = rtw_sa2400_tune; in rtw_sa2400_create()
462 rf->rf_pwrstate = rtw_sa2400_pwrstate; in rtw_sa2400_create()
463 bb = &rf->rf_bbpset; in rtw_sa2400_create()
491 rtw_max2820_tune(struct rtw_rf *rf, uint_t freq) in rtw_max2820_tune() argument
493 struct rtw_max2820 *mx = (struct rtw_max2820 *)rf; in rtw_max2820_tune()
504 rtw_max2820_destroy(struct rtw_rf *rf) in rtw_max2820_destroy() argument
506 struct rtw_max2820 *mx = (struct rtw_max2820 *)rf; in rtw_max2820_destroy()
512 rtw_max2820_init(struct rtw_rf *rf, uint_t freq, uint8_t opaque_txpower, in rtw_max2820_init() argument
515 struct rtw_max2820 *mx = (struct rtw_max2820 *)rf; in rtw_max2820_init()
530 if ((rc = rtw_max2820_pwrstate(rf, power)) != 0) in rtw_max2820_init()
539 if ((rc = rtw_max2820_tune(rf, freq)) != 0) in rtw_max2820_init()
559 rtw_max2820_txpower(struct rtw_rf *rf, uint8_t opaque_txpower) in rtw_max2820_txpower() argument
566 rtw_max2820_pwrstate(struct rtw_rf *rf, enum rtw_pwrstate power) in rtw_max2820_pwrstate() argument
572 mx = (struct rtw_max2820 *)rf; in rtw_max2820_pwrstate()
594 struct rtw_rf *rf; in rtw_max2820_create() local
603 rf = &mx->mx_rf; in rtw_max2820_create()
606 rf->rf_init = rtw_max2820_init; in rtw_max2820_create()
607 rf->rf_destroy = rtw_max2820_destroy; in rtw_max2820_create()
608 rf->rf_txpower = rtw_max2820_txpower; in rtw_max2820_create()
609 rf->rf_tune = rtw_max2820_tune; in rtw_max2820_create()
610 rf->rf_pwrstate = rtw_max2820_pwrstate; in rtw_max2820_create()
611 bb = &rf->rf_bbpset; in rtw_max2820_create()
639 rtw_phy_init(struct rtw_regs *regs, struct rtw_rf *rf, uint8_t opaque_txpower, in rtw_phy_init() argument
648 if ((rc = rtw_rf_txpower(rf, opaque_txpower)) != 0) in rtw_phy_init()
650 if ((rc = rtw_bbp_preinit(regs, rf->rf_bbpset.bb_antatten, dflantb, in rtw_phy_init()
653 if ((rc = rtw_rf_tune(rf, freq)) != 0) in rtw_phy_init()
658 if ((rc = rtw_rf_init(rf, freq, opaque_txpower, power)) != 0) in rtw_phy_init()
662 if ((rc = rtw_rf_txpower(rf, opaque_txpower)) != 0) in rtw_phy_init()
665 return (rtw_bbp_init(regs, &rf->rf_bbpset, antdiv, dflantb, in rtw_phy_init()